照片为什么不能黏贴到excel表格
作者:路由通
|
114人看过
发布时间:2026-03-03 13:07:48
标签:
在日常办公中,许多用户习惯将照片直接拖拽或复制到电子表格软件(Excel)中,却发现操作常常失败或效果不佳。这背后涉及电子表格软件的核心设计理念、数据存储机制以及图像处理逻辑的根本差异。本文将深入剖析照片无法直接“黏贴”到电子表格单元格的十二个关键原因,从软件底层架构到用户操作逻辑,提供全面的专业解读与实用的替代解决方案,帮助读者从根本上理解并高效处理表格与图像的整合需求。
在日常办公场景中,微软公司的电子表格软件(Microsoft Excel)是处理数据、进行分析和制作报表的利器。然而,一个常见的困扰是:当我们试图将一张来自文件夹、网页或聊天窗口的图片,像处理一段文字那样,通过“复制”与“粘贴”命令直接放入电子表格的某个单元格时,操作往往不如预期。图片要么悬浮在单元格上方,要么根本无法嵌入,这不禁让人疑惑:为什么功能如此强大的电子表格软件,在对待图像时却显得如此“不近人情”?本文将深入探讨这一现象背后的技术原理与设计逻辑,并为您梳理出清晰的理解脉络和实用的操作方法。 核心设计目标的根本分野 首先,我们必须理解电子表格软件与图像处理软件(例如Adobe Photoshop)或演示文稿软件(例如Microsoft PowerPoint)在设计初衷上的本质区别。电子表格的诞生是为了高效、精确地处理结构化数据。其每一个单元格都是一个独立的数据容器,主要设计用于存储和计算数字、日期、文本等离散的、可被公式引用的信息。而图像是一种非结构化的、连续性的二进制数据对象。将图像“存入”一个旨在处理“值”的单元格,就像试图把一整幅油画塞进一个存放数字的档案盒——两者的物理形态和存储需求存在根本性冲突。电子表格软件并非不能容纳图像,但其容纳方式并非“单元格存储”,而是“图层悬浮”,这构成了所有问题的起点。 单元格数据类型的严格限定 电子表格的单元格属性在软件底层被严格定义。常见的单元格格式包括“常规”、“数值”、“货币”、“日期”、“文本”等。当您向单元格输入内容时,软件会尝试根据格式设置和输入内容自动或手动判断其数据类型。然而,在所有预设的数据类型中,并不存在一种名为“图像”或“图片”的格式。这意味着,从软件的逻辑层面,单元格就没有被赋予直接承载和解析图像二进制数据的能力。粘贴图像数据到单元格,软件无法将其识别为有效的“值”,因此默认处理方式就是将其作为一个独立的对象放置在表格之上,而非之内。 图像作为“对象”而非“值”的存在 在电子表格软件的对象模型中,从外部插入的图片、形状、图表等都被统称为“对象”或“浮层对象”。它们与单元格网格存在于不同的“层”。单元格网格构成底层的数据层,而这些对象则处于上方的绘图层。这种分层架构使得对象可以自由移动、调整大小,且不影响底层单元格的数据和公式计算。当您执行“粘贴图片”操作时,软件实际上是在绘图层创建了一个新的图像对象,并将其锚点与某个单元格关联(以便随单元格移动),但图像本身并非单元格的内容。这与将文本“值”粘贴到单元格内,成为单元格不可分割的一部分,是两种截然不同的操作。 存储与链接机制的差异 单元格内存储的文本或数字,其数据直接保存在电子表格文件(例如.xlsx文件)内部。而插入的图片则有两种处理方式:嵌入或链接。默认情况下,现代电子表格软件通常会将图片的完整数据嵌入到文件中,这会导致文件体积显著增大。另一种方式是链接到外部图像文件,此时表格内仅保存一个指向文件路径的链接。无论是嵌入还是链接,这些信息都不是以“单元格值”的形式存储的,而是作为文件包内一个独立的部件(在开放打包约定文件格式中,图片是存储在“xl/media”文件夹内的独立文件条目)。因此,从文件结构上看,图片与单元格数据本就是分离的。 公式与引用系统的局限性 电子表格的强大功能很大程度上依赖于其公式系统。公式可以对单元格中的值进行引用、计算和操作。如果图片成为单元格的“值”,那么一个随之而来的问题是:公式该如何引用一张图片?是引用其像素数据、颜色平均值,还是文件大小?这在数学和逻辑上缺乏统一定义,且无实际计算意义。电子表格的引用系统(如A1、B2)是为标量值(单个数值)或数组设计的,无法指向一个复杂的、多维的图像对象。因此,从功能一致性考虑,将图片排除在单元格值体系之外是合理的设计选择。 排序与筛选功能的影响 排序和筛选是电子表格处理数据的两大核心操作。它们的工作机制是基于单元格内的值进行比较和筛选。如果图片作为单元格内容,在对该列进行排序时,软件应如何决定哪张图片“更大”或“更小”?是按照文件名、文件大小,还是创建日期?这没有标准答案,强行定义会导致混乱和不可预知的结果。同样,筛选操作也无法对图像内容进行逻辑判断。为了保持排序和筛选功能的纯粹性与可靠性,电子表格软件选择不让图像参与这些数据操作,从而避免了功能逻辑的崩溃。 单元格尺寸与图像尺寸的动态矛盾 单元格的行高和列宽是可以调整的,但通常有最小和最大限制,且调整是基于数据呈现的需求(如文本长度)。一张图片则有固定的像素尺寸。如果将图片强行“塞入”一个固定大小的单元格,必然面临裁剪或压缩变形的问题。是让单元格自动扩张以适应图片,还是让图片自动缩放以适应单元格?前者会打乱整个表格的布局,后者会损害图像质量。电子表格软件选择将图像作为浮动对象,允许用户自由调整其大小和位置,从而将布局控制权交给用户,而不是通过一套复杂的自动规则来处理,这实际上提供了更大的灵活性。 性能与渲染效率的考量 处理大量单元格的数值计算和文本渲染已经对软件性能构成一定压力。图像数据,尤其是高分辨率照片,其数据量远大于文本。如果成千上万的单元格都内嵌了图片,那么在滚动、计算、重绘屏幕时,软件需要渲染海量的图像数据,这将导致严重的性能下降,甚至软件卡死或无响应。将图片作为独立于网格的对象进行管理,软件可以采用更优化的渲染策略,例如只渲染可视区域内的图片,或对离屏图片进行延迟加载,从而保证基本的表格操作流畅性。 剪贴板数据格式的兼容性问题 当我们复制一张图片时,操作系统剪贴板中可能同时存储了多种格式的数据,例如位图格式、设备无关位图格式、甚至富文本格式。电子表格软件的粘贴命令需要解析剪贴板内容。当它检测到主要数据是图像格式时,其预设的行为就是“粘贴为图片对象”。它并没有设计一个流程去将图像数据转换为某种可存入单元格的编码形式(如将像素颜色值转换成一长串文本代码),因为这样的转换结果对用户毫无用处,且会占用巨大空间。 跨平台与版本兼容性的挑战 电子表格文件需要在不同版本(如2016、2019、Microsoft 365)甚至不同厂商的软件(如LibreOffice Calc、WPS表格)中保持兼容。如果定义一种将图像作为单元格值存储的私有复杂格式,将极大地破坏文件的互操作性。其他软件可能无法解析这种自定义格式,导致数据丢失或显示错误。而将图像作为遵循通用标准的独立对象(如可扩展标记语言图片)嵌入,则是更安全、更通用的做法,确保了文件在不同环境下的可读性。 数据导出与交换的障碍 电子表格数据经常需要导出为其他格式,如逗号分隔值文件或纯文本文件,以供其他系统读取。这些格式仅能处理文本和数字。如果图片存储在单元格内,在导出为逗号分隔值文件时,这些图片数据将完全丢失或导致文件格式错误。将图片作为独立对象处理,在导出为逗号分隔值文件时,软件可以自然地忽略它们,只导出真正的表格数据,保证了核心数据交换的纯净性。 辅助功能与无障碍访问的规范 对于视障用户依赖屏幕阅读器来“听”表格内容。屏幕阅读器通过读取单元格内的文本来工作。如果单元格内是一张图片,屏幕阅读器将无法获取任何有意义的信息。现代软件设计强调无障碍访问。将图片作为对象,允许用户为其添加“替代文本”(Alt Text),描述图片内容。这样,屏幕阅读器可以朗读这段替代文本,使视障用户也能理解图片的存在和含义。如果图片是单元格值,这套成熟的无障碍支持机制将难以实施。 “插入”与“粘贴”的功能定位区分 电子表格软件的功能菜单明确区分了“插入图片”和普通的“粘贴”命令。这并非偶然,而是有意为之的功能划分。“插入”操作专门用于向文档中添加非数据对象,如图片、形状、图标、文本框等。而“粘贴”命令,在表格上下文中的首要预期是粘贴“数据”——即来自其他单元格或程序的文本、数字、公式等。这种区分引导用户使用正确的工具完成正确的任务,符合软件的人机交互设计原则。 单元格合并与图片显示的冲突 用户有时会通过合并单元格来创建一个较大的区域以放置图片。即便如此,图片仍然是放置在合并后区域“上方”的对象,而非“内部”的值。如果图片真的是单元格值,那么当取消单元格合并时,这张图片应该归属于哪个原始小单元格?这会造成逻辑上的困境。作为浮动对象,图片的锚点可以设置为合并单元格,取消合并后,图片的锚点可能会自动调整到左上角的单元格,行为是可预测和可管理的。 从数据库理论看结构化与非结构化数据 从更抽象的数据管理视角看,电子表格可视作一个二维的关系型数据表。每一列代表一个字段(属性),每一行代表一条记录。每个字段应有明确、统一的数据类型。图像属于非结构化数据,与数据库中的二进制大对象字段类似。在专业数据库中,二进制大对象字段通常也是单独存储和引用,而非与其他结构化字段混杂在同一个存储块。电子表格的设计暗合了这一数据处理的基本原则,将结构化数据(单元格值)与非结构化数据(图像对象)分开管理。 历史沿袭与用户习惯的路径依赖 电子表格软件的发展史有数十年,其基本交互模型早已深入人心。早期版本处理图形能力很弱,图片支持是后来逐步加强的功能。但“图片作为浮动对象”这一基本范式一旦确立,就被后续版本继承,以保持用户操作的连续性和习惯。改变这一底层逻辑,意味着颠覆无数用户和第三方插件、宏代码的既有工作方式,成本极高且收益不明确,因此软件厂商缺乏根本性改变的动力。 那么,如何实现“图片在单元格内”的效果? 理解了原理,我们便能找到正确的工作方法。虽然无法让图片成为单元格的“值”,但可以通过技巧让图片看起来与单元格紧密结合:1. 使用“插入”功能添加图片后,右键点击图片,选择“大小和属性”,在“属性”中设置为“随单元格改变位置和大小”。这样,当调整行高列宽时,图片会自动适应。2. 将图片的锚点与特定单元格对齐,并利用“置于底层”功能,可以将图片作为单元格背景。3. 对于需要将图片与数据严格关联的情况(如产品目录),可以使用“链接的图片”功能:先将产品图片插入到表格一侧,然后使用“照相机”工具(或通过公式引用生成图片)创建与单元格区域链接的图片,但这本质上仍是对象。 综上所述,照片不能像文本一样黏贴到电子表格的单元格内,并非软件的功能缺陷,而是由其核心使命——处理结构化数据——所决定的深层设计选择。这一设计保证了数据计算的严谨性、文件操作的性能以及跨平台的兼容性。作为用户,认识到这种差异,并掌握正确的图片插入与管理技巧,方能更高效地运用电子表格软件,制作出既美观又专业的数据文档。
相关文章
当您通过手机打开从电脑端传输的电子表格文件时,是否常遇到图表或形状位置偏移、排版混乱的困扰?这并非简单的显示故障,其背后涉及文件格式兼容性、屏幕尺寸适配、软件渲染机制以及操作系统差异等多重复杂因素。本文将深入剖析导致移动设备上表格内容错位的十二个核心原因,并提供一系列经过验证的实用解决方案,帮助您在不同设备间实现数据与版式的无缝衔接。
2026-03-03 13:07:44
365人看过
许多用户在使用表格处理软件进行文档打印预览时,会发现页面内容呈现倾斜状态,这并非软件故障,而是一个涉及显示逻辑、页面布局与打印驱动交互的综合性技术现象。本文将深入剖析其背后的十二个核心成因,涵盖从默认视图设置、缩放比例适配到打印机驱动程序兼容性等关键环节,并提供一系列经过验证的实用解决方案,帮助读者彻底理解并解决这一常见困扰。
2026-03-03 13:07:34
62人看过
在微软公司的文字处理软件中,用户可以通过多种便捷的途径查看文档的字数统计信息。这些方法不仅包括状态栏的实时显示,还涵盖了“审阅”选项卡中的详细统计对话框、键盘快捷键调用以及针对特定文本范围的字数查看功能。了解并掌握这些查看方式,对于需要进行精准字数控制的学生、作者、编辑以及各类办公人员而言,具有极高的实用价值,是提升文档处理效率的关键技能之一。
2026-03-03 13:06:34
69人看过
当我们在日常办公中遇到文字处理软件中的删除键失灵时,这背后往往不是简单的键盘故障。实际上,这可能是由多种深层原因交织导致的复杂问题。本文将深入剖析这一现象,从软件本身的功能限制、文档的格式保护机制,到系统层面的快捷键冲突、输入法状态影响,乃至隐藏的插件干扰和宏命令锁定等十二个核心维度进行系统性阐述。通过结合微软官方文档与技术支持资料,我们旨在为您提供一个全面、专业且具备可操作性的深度指南,帮助您彻底理解并解决这一困扰众多用户的难题。
2026-03-03 13:06:14
314人看过
在微软Word中,用户常发现缺少直接的“分散对齐”按钮,这并非软件功能缺失,而是其设计逻辑与排版哲学的综合体现。本文从软件界面演化、排版规范、跨文化文本处理等角度,深入剖析Word对齐功能的底层逻辑,揭示其如何通过字符间距、段落缩进等组合工具实现分散对齐效果,并探讨未来排版工具的发展趋势。
2026-03-03 13:06:08
138人看过
在日常使用文档处理软件时,用户偶尔会遇到无法输入文字的困扰。这种状况可能由多种原因引发,从简单的界面设置失误到复杂的软件或系统故障。本文将深入剖析导致这一问题的十二个核心原因,涵盖权限限制、视图模式、加载项冲突、文件损坏、键盘与输入法问题、软件修复与更新等层面,并提供一系列经过验证的解决方案,旨在帮助用户系统性地排查并解决问题,恢复文档的正常编辑功能。
2026-03-03 13:06:00
153人看过
热门推荐
资讯中心:
.webp)
.webp)

.webp)
.webp)
.webp)